What is Stickman Clash

Stickman Clash is a fast, funny action brawler where simple stick figures turn into chaotic warriors. Each round drops you into a small arena, hands you a weapon or lets you grab one, and asks one question: can you outplay everyone before the stage turns against you? The charm comes from its mix of quick reactions and silly physics. Characters tumble, weapons swing wide, and a lucky shove can flip a fight in one second.

At the same time, the rules are easy to learn. You move, jump, attack, and use the arena to your advantage. That makes Stickman Clash great for short breaks, friendly rivalries, and casual players who still want depth. Many versions include multiple modes such as solo battles, versus matches, and survival style rounds where waves of enemies keep coming.

How to Control Stickman Clash

PC and Laptop Controls

Most browser builds use a familiar keyboard layout:

Move with W, A, S, D.
Jump with Space.
Attack with your action key or left mouse click.
Pick up items or interact with E.
Switch weapons with Q when the mode supports multiple weapons.

Because versions can differ slightly, always check the in game controls screen the first time you play. Some builds also support local multiplayer, where each player uses a different key cluster on the same keyboard.

Mobile and Touch Controls

On touch screens, Stickman Clash usually maps movement to an on screen joystick and maps attacks to tap buttons. If you play on mobile, use a steady grip and keep your thumbs relaxed. The game rewards timing more than frantic tapping.

Movement and Combat Tips

In this game, movement is defense. Small steps help you bait swings, while jumps help you avoid floor hazards and weapon arcs. Try to fight near the center when you are learning, then push opponents toward traps once you understand each arena. When a weapon drops, decide fast: grab it if you can do it safely, or strike the opponent during the pickup animation.

Game Modes You Will See Often

Versus Duels

Versus is the classic match style. You face a friend or a CPU opponent, learn weapon timing, and play the arena. A good duel has a rhythm: poke, retreat, punish, then finish.

Survival and Boss Style Rounds

Survival mode pushes endurance. Enemies arrive in waves, and your goal is to stay alive while collecting better tools. Some versions add boss fights where one enemy has extra health or unusual patterns.

Party Chaos and Custom Rules

Some releases offer rule switches such as stronger hazards, faster knockouts, or altered gravity. Custom rules keep the game fresh and help groups of different skill levels enjoy the same match.

Why is it lagging in my browser?

Lag usually comes from one of three things: a busy browser, a slow device, or a heavy background download. Try closing other tabs, turning off extensions you do not need, and lowering the game quality setting if available. A quick refresh often fixes audio or input delay too.

How do I get better quickly?

Start with basics. Learn one weapon type, practice spacing, and focus on staying balanced. Overcommitting is the fastest way to lose. Wait for an opponent swing, step aside, then punish during recovery. Also learn each arena hazard so you stop taking free damage.
